Table of Contents
ToggleWhat Makes a Good UI Designer?
In the ever-evolving world of digital design, the role of a UI (User Interface) designer has become crucial. A good UI designer is not just someone who makes things look pretty, they play a vital role in creating functional, and aesthetically pleasing interfaces that enhance user experience. This article delves into the essential qualities, skills, and practices that define a good UI designer.
1. Understanding of User-Centered Design
At the core of good UI design is a deep understanding of user-centered design (UCD). A good UI designer prioritizes the user’s needs, preferences, and behaviors. They understand that the primary goal of UI design is to make digital products accessible and easy to use. This involves:
- Empathy: Understanding the user’s pain points and designing solutions that address them.
- User Research: Conducting surveys, interviews, and usability tests to gather insights.
- Personas and Scenarios: Creating user personas and scenarios to guide design decisions.
2. Strong Visual Design Skills
Aesthetic appeal is a critical aspect of UI design. A good UI designer possesses strong visual design skills, including:
- Color Theory: Understanding color psychology and choosing color schemes that align with the brand and evoke the desired emotions.
- Typography: Selecting appropriate fonts and ensuring readability and accessibility.
- Layout and Composition: Arranging elements on the screen in a way that guides the user’s eye and enhances usability.
- Consistency: Maintaining visual consistency across all screens and elements.
3. Proficiency in Design Tools
Mastery of design tools is essential for any UI designer. Some of the most commonly used tools include:
- Adobe XD, Figma, Sketch: For creating wireframes, prototypes, and high-fidelity designs.
- Photoshop and Illustrator: For graphic design and image editing.
- Prototyping Tools: Like InVision or Marvel for creating interactive prototypes.
4. Understanding of Interaction Design
Interaction design focuses on how users interact with a product. A good UI designer considers the following:
- Microinteractions: Small animations or responses that provide feedback and enhance user experience (e.g., button animations, loading spinners).
- User Flow: Ensuring smooth navigation and flow through the interface.
- Affordances: Making it clear how users can interact with different elements (e.g., buttons, links).
5. Knowledge of Accessibility Standards
Accessibility is a crucial aspect of UI design. A good UI designer ensures that the product is usable by as many people as possible, including those with disabilities. This involves:
- Contrast Ratios: Ensuring text is readable against background colors.
- Keyboard Navigation: Making sure users can navigate the interface using a keyboard.
- Screen Reader Compatibility: Designing for compatibility with screen readers.
6. Effective Communication Skills
A good UI designer must communicate effectively with various stakeholders, including:
- Clients: Understanding their vision and requirements.
- Developers: Collaborating to ensure design feasibility and proper implementation.
- Team Members: Sharing ideas and providing constructive feedback.
7. Attention to Detail
Details can make or break a design. A good UI designer pays attention to:
- Spacing and Alignment: Ensuring elements are aligned and spaced correctly for a clean, organized look.
- Iconography: Choosing or designing icons that are clear and intuitive.
- Consistency: Maintaining consistency in design elements, such as buttons, icons, and typography.
8. Adaptability and Willingness to Learn
The field of UI design is constantly evolving, with new tools, technologies, and design trends emerging regularly. A good UI designer:
- Stays Updated: Keeps up with the latest design trends, tools, and best practices.
- Embraces Feedback: Is open to constructive criticism and uses it to improve their work.
- Continuous Learning: Pursues ongoing education and training to refine their skills.
9. Problem-Solving Skills
UI design often involves solving complex problems. A good UI designer:
- Identifies Issues: Quickly identifies usability issues and finds creative solutions.
- Iterates: Works through multiple iterations to refine the design.
- User Testing: Conducts user testing to identify and address potential issues before the final release.
10. Understanding of Business Goals
A good UI designer understands that design is not just about aesthetics; it’s also about meeting business objectives. This includes:
- Brand Alignment: Ensuring the design aligns with the brand’s identity and values.
- Conversion Optimization: Designing interfaces that encourage desired user actions, such as signing up or making a purchase.
- Analytics and Metrics: Understanding and using data to inform design decisions and measure success.
11. Passion and Curiosity
Passion for design and a curious mindset are vital qualities of a good UI designer. They are:
- Passionate: Genuinely interested in design and eager to create beautiful and functional interfaces.
- Curious: Always exploring new design concepts, techniques, and tools.
12. Collaboration and Teamwork
UI design often requires collaboration with other designers, developers, and stakeholders. A good UI designer:
- Works Well in a Team: Communicates effectively and collaborates with team members.
- Shares Knowledge: Shares their knowledge and insights with others.
- Open to Collaboration: Values the input and ideas of others and works together to achieve the best results.
13. Portfolio and Case Studies
A strong portfolio showcases a UI designer’s skills and experience. A good portfolio includes:
- Diverse Projects: A variety of projects that demonstrate different skills and styles.
- Case Studies: Detailed case studies that explain the design process, challenges, and solutions.
- Visual and Interactive Elements: High-quality visuals and interactive prototypes that showcase the designer’s abilities.
Conclusion
A good UI designer is a blend of artist, engineer, and psychologist. They have a keen eye for aesthetics, a deep understanding of user behavior, and the technical skills to bring their designs to life. They are adaptable, communicative, and always eager to learn and grow. By balancing user needs with business goals, a good UI designer creates interfaces that are not only visually appealing but also highly functional and effective.
In the fast-paced world of digital design, the role of a UI designer is more important than ever. By mastering the skills and qualities outlined in this article, aspiring UI designers can set themselves apart and create interfaces that delight users and drive success.